Natural Peppermint Lip Balm
From karlyn255 14 years agoIngredients
- 1½ oz beeswax pearls shopping list
- 1 oz cocoa butter shopping list
- 1½ oz mango butter shopping list
- 1 oz. sunflower oil shopping list
- 1/2 oz. almond oil shopping list
- 1/2 oz. jojoba oil shopping list
- 1 teaspoon coconut oil (any kind) shopping list
- 1-2 teaspoons peppermint essential oil shopping list
- 5-10 drops rosemary oil extract (ROE) shopping list
How to make it
- Weigh all ingredients.
- In a very small pan, add the beeswax and melt over the lowest setting.
- Once melted add the cocoa butter chunks and shea butter, let melt, and then add the sweet almond oil.
- Heat through.
- Add the Vitamin E oil.
- Remove from stove and pour into a glass measuring cup for easy pouring into lip balm containers.
- Add the flavor oil, or if you would like to make more than one flavor with this recipe, separate into different glass jars or cups and then add the flavor oils.
- Adjust the amount of flavor oil accordingly.
- Stir flavor oils in and pour into lip balm containers.
- If the mixture starts to harden, place in the microwave for a few seconds to re-melt and then pour.
